Range of Hardware-Generated PRBS Patterns
The following table lists the hardware-generated 2^n -1 PRBS pattern lengths that
correspond to different n values. This is before the pattern is finally inverted.
Table 12
n Sequence Length Longest Run of 1's Longest Run of 0's
7 127 7 6
10 1,023 10 9
11 2,047 11 10
15 32,767 15 14
23 8,388,607 23 22
31 2,147,483,647 31 30
Decimation of PRBS Patterns
A special property of 2^n -1 PRBS patterns is that they can be demultiplexed into
the same patterns at slower speeds with different phases. This is also true for
multiplexing. The demux or mux must have n ports.
